It shoots Awesome!!! I have sold my Switchback and I have already bought one!!! It is extremely smooth and smokin fast!! I Chronoed my Switchback and the Trykon Side by side same set up and arrow. My Switchback 277 fps and the Trykon292 fps!! I really was pleased. My archery shop isselling them for $629.00. Hope that helps.

I have not shot the XL Version. I like the 33 ATA. But I am not a very tall guy so I know that biggerfolks lots of times like the longer ATA. Also 95 percent of my hunting is done from a tree stand therefore making the shorter ATA better for me. I have talked to a guy who has shot both and said they felt pretty much the same. But I would definately shoot them both and not take anyones word for it. It is amazing how minor differences can feel enormously different to other people.
